How much cash has private treatment at Noble's Hospital made, and what has the money been spent on?
That's the question North Douglas MHK John Wannenburgh wants Health Minister Lawrie Hooper to answer.
Mr Wannenburgh has asked a question for written reply about the total net contribution of the Private Medical Wing over the last five years it operated.
He's also asked whether that money went towards funding the Island's health service.
